Audrey AI Secures $1.8M Pre-Seed Funding for Expansion

Audrey AI has successfully closed a $1.8 million pre-seed funding round aimed at scaling its operations in the auditing and engineering sectors. The investment is expected to facilitate expansion primarily within Ireland and the UK, underscoring the growing importance of AI-native solutions in traditional industries.
